SQL Server в облака
С SQL Azure, Microsoft предлага на сериозните потребители на база данни възможността да поставят своите бази данни в облака. SQL Azure е релационна база данни, която поддържа Transact-SQL посредством технологията Microsoft SQL Server, но ви позволява да поставите всички задачи за администриране на сървъри и операционни системи в ръцете на инженерите на Microsoft.
Характеристики на SQL Server в облака
Някои от функциите, които ще получите чрез SQL Azure, са:
- Опростена администрация, оставяйки управлението на платформата за бази данни, операционната система и хардуера в ръцете на другите
- Мащабируеми ресурси, което ви позволява бързо да добавяте или премахвате ресурси, докато вашите нужди се променят
- Интеграция с ODBC, PHP и ADO.NET достъп до данни
- Управление чрез SQL Server Management Studio (използвайки версията, доставена със SQL Server 2008 R2 или по-нова версия)
- Повечето от основните функции на Microsoft SQL Server
Ограничения
Важно е да признаем, че докато SQL Azure е алтернатива на Microsoft SQL Server, базирана на облак, тя не е същата като хоствана среда на SQL Server. Има няколко важни отличия
- Базите данни са ограничени до 10 ГБ.
- Някои типове данни (по-специално типовете данни CLR, които включват геопространствени данни) не се поддържат
- Неясни предупреждения, че връзката ви може да бъде прекратена за "прекомерно използване на ресурсите"
заключение
Като цяло, SQL Azure е много интересен продукт и може да е доста привлекателен за тези в определена ниша, търсеща високоефективни бази данни на база клауд под 10GB. Въпреки това, повечето уеб потребители вероятно ще открият, че могат да намерят подобно ценообразуване от различни интернет доставчици, които включват разходите за уеб хостинг. Очаквайте SQL Azure да расте в популярност, тъй като тя разгръща по-мащабируеми решения, поддържащи по-напреднала функционалност на SQL Server.